2 U.S.C. § 69a - Transferred

Notes

Editorial Notes

Codification Section 69a was editorially reclassified as section 6514 of this title.

Prior ProvisionsA prior section 69a, Pub. L. 9594, title I, § 105, Aug. 5, 1977, 91 Stat. 661, provided for expenditure of $1,000 during any fiscal year to conduct orientation seminars for new Senators and their staffs, prior to repeal, effective July 1, 1979, by Pub. L. 9638, title I, § 107(b), July 25, 1979, 93 Stat. 113.
